I know there is a problem with Unicode (Windows) and non-Unicode (AIX).
I've restored a Windows client on AIX and after that nothing could be
done anymore with the AIX client, because it's type got changed to
Unicode.

So I think your conclusion might be right.

I've read the following comment in the TSM admin manual:

"Software for writing CDs may not work consistently across platforms."

I conclude that it is not practical to generate a backupset on an AIX
server
and use that CD on a windows client.

Anyone ever done that?
